In November 2007, six students studying communications design, two studying industrial design, and 14 studying product design engineering embraced the German winter to take part in a program of cultural, historical and design related visits.

Together with Senior Lecturer Lotars Ginters, the students spent three weeks touring Germany and its cultural and design sites including the Bauhaus, the Hessen Design Centre, BMW, Wilkhan Gmbh, and the Braun Museum and Archives.
They were then based at FH-Hildesheim for three weeks of project work under the guidance of German design staff. The project was introduced by the Wilkhan design management team and the students spent an informative day at the firm receiving project briefing, design studio and factory tours. Final project presentation was to Wilkhan and FH-Hildesheim staff.
